Page 13

13VQT1L50
Preparation
and discharges.
We recommend charging the batteries 
after they are fully discharged. If you 
charge the batteries before they are 
fully discharged, it can reduce battery 
performance. This is called “memory 
effect”.
If “memory effect” occurs, continue using 
the batteries until the camera stops 
working and then charge them fully.
Battery performance will be restored after 
a few charges and discharges.
Over time Ni-MH batteries naturally 
discharge and their capacity lowers even...

Page 16

16VQT1L50
Preparation
About the  Built-in Memory/the  Card
The built-in memory can be used as a 
temporary storage device when the card 
being used becomes full. 
   
Built-in Memory [ 
 ]
You can record or play back pictures 
on the built-in memory when you 
are not using a card. (The built-in 
memory cannot be used when a card is 
inserted.)
You can copy pictures from the built-
in memory to a card 
( P86 ).
The built-in memory capacity is about 
24 MB.
Picture size is fi xed to QVGA (320 × 
240 pixels)...
